SR. PROJECT MANAGER-SUSTAINABILITY REPORTING & CONTROLS (HYBRID-CHARLOTTE, NC)

Remote Full-time
About the position Responsibilities • Develop, launch and maintain reporting controls, workflows and templates to capture sustainability data (Scope 1, 2 & 3 emissions; food waste; animal welfare) reliably and efficiently. • Consolidate data across multiple files/systems and departments (e.g., operations, supply chain, procurement, finance) using Excel lookup functions, pivot analyses and variance checks. • Conduct thorough quality control reviews of submitted data: identify anomalies, duplicates, inconsistencies, missing inputs, and ensure data integrity before final submission. • Perform year-over-year variance analysis across sustainability metrics, flagging significant movements (e.g., >10%) and preparing commentary/explanations for leadership. • Engage with business partners throughout the organization to collect, review, validate and reconcile data. Establish strong partner relationships and data ownership. • Present findings, dashboards and summary reports to leadership for approval, highlighting key trends, risks, and opportunities. • Drive the implementation of new controls, automation opportunities, and process improvements to streamline future reporting cycles. • Act with a strong sense of urgency to meet firm annual deadlines for sustainability reporting, ensuring all milestones are tracked and met.
